From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.ffmpeg.org (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TPS id 8E7754FEAC for ; Thu, 3 Jul 2025 16:54:27 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.ffmpeg.org (Postfix) with ESMTP id 2A29E68EE18; Thu, 3 Jul 2025 19:54:24 +0300 (EEST) Received: from EUR03-AM7-obe.outbound.protection.outlook.com (mail-am7eur03olkn2066.outbound.protection.outlook.com [40.92.59.66]) by ffbox0-bg.ffmpeg.org (Postfix) with ESMTPS id 5DCE768EDC6 for ; Thu, 3 Jul 2025 19:54:17 +0300 (EEST) ARC-Seal: i=1; a=rsa-sha256; s=arcselector10001; d=microsoft.com; cv=none; b=QqeYocownei4Cyp+NJyAEENsdbVysQLp9Z6V4K5r8pZUtHl/e7+W5jrgGitaJ593htPHv1VRw3HrUyUB8pdnhFCQwjw9at3qm/liv5msykTEPXVyz26RtILMe4C+nGplqAvmBi2jzunoulJdA6jm2HaZOv/mW8O7sc+kTy16DB4dPrC6rZNqGH9O3j4+A+q3cmMYiEbed2e6twSmNvfAPmVmTG8IuBC8etmDv6pN4JVSp+WWKPKmbSwcxzSgR6R+kAUhahZFb5EPq4EJAl6xe4Crcav1zoXS6Qzuj85F/QrswU6WzVKpHNqPGHWYHTRQORnP8Ur4KxHYX9sb/gbeVQ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ector10001;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=H6TK9rA/HeeD1QzxlX4H35RQu40/Gl/3RJ1uKwfsokc=; b=O6eQuxmmsrkzYcKlUp6T4xRdnT/KGNfuJZRe3R0qATIeJ8XRrWoSQN88GCV5jIpEOGeZj32PbQsGxJm/87+WzP/wdu1jVsZ8qje6ohnC3qhkxphlsY6ZkmKGpjHpO2uQdU8+ciRto51y1ZNBIQlH31O4S8vuMga18WU0AejnGXeM5uWsSTk5FSWT7j5f+6LS018wT9jHKPAc9w2bQql+sAbOUJZ6EI6DfAxS3PPp0G/mcx2uHVmYjIVVTnmeqkRYygT2RSGa6miJxp9Et9imTJAg92wW3vnxEiTi5nEbuSMV4PU5dzgjUb1fhak2eSgLrzVWZPufvvOaIkYaTyaaGg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=outlook.com; s=selector1;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=H6TK9rA/HeeD1QzxlX4H35RQu40/Gl/3RJ1uKwfsokc=; b=I4Wohn7NY9zvPzyF5jX0GtBGz7YB5OY8uDlhCeTd6dQaNnGbjKyydf6DJrNZDGz8FSB7ECVeaJCesj2VC4SxoeLuLeKb6O2RNfcuYW6T90g5ZF8l6ziE3HFZ3K2TkgXyjD1JdUasJYdK99B1kJ35PQalBsUUXvaklI3n7uhpOxpZfBc4acDv2G8UnGi1VRsnJw/j7GKY4ZbadSoyRLBha5RsZ7oJQJSiOrHFwbHHQi7khPVJuD8osTAi0q9DuyAqPWyFlmQU3zhj98Tl9K1et3exjLTWJRQfu3TPCzXJAx41vHeNbek5Ae00nnXiMTZa/8gzsdkhdLQ9ohUcwpeWfA== Received: from AS8P250MB0744.EURP250.PROD.OUTLOOK.COM (2603:10a6:20b:541::14) by GV2P250MB0755.EURP250.PROD.OUTLOOK.COM (2603:10a6:150:7f::19)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.8901.21; Thu, 3 Jul 2025 16:54:15 +0000 Received: from AS8P250MB0744.EURP250.PROD.OUTLOOK.COM ([fe80::384d:40d4:ecb7:1c9]) by AS8P250MB0744.EURP250.PROD.OUTLOOK.COM ([fe80::384d:40d4:ecb7:1c9%6]) with mapi id 15.20.8901.018; Thu, 3 Jul 2025 16:54:15 +0000 Message-ID: Date: Thu, 3 Jul 2025 18:54:14 +0200 User-Agent: Mozilla Thunderbird To: ffmpegagent , ffmpeg-devel@ffmpeg.org References: Content-Language: en-US From: Andreas Rheinhardt In-Reply-To: X-ClientProxiedBy: FR2P281CA0134.DEUP281.PROD.OUTLOOK.COM (2603:10a6:d10:9e::13) To AS8P250MB0744.EURP250.PROD.OUTLOOK.COM (2603:10a6:20b:541::14) X-Microsoft-Original-Message-ID: <99551f2c-4f58-4a79-8b0c-a0790bbd7574@outlook.com> MIME-Version: 1.0 X-MS-Exchange-MessageSentRepresentingType: 1 X-MS-PublicTrafficType: Email X-MS-TrafficTypeDiagnostic: AS8P250MB0744:EE_|GV2P250MB0755:EE_ X-MS-Office365-Filtering-Correlation-Id: 085b8b31-4912-480a-29f6-08ddba523e57 X-Microsoft-Antispam: BCL:0; ARA:14566002|7092599006|15080799009|19110799006|5072599009|461199028|8060799009|6090799003|440099028|3412199025|4302099013|40105399003|10035399007|1602099012; X-Microsoft-Antispam-Message-Info: =?utf-8?B?NmlmS1ZzMzNldUdQT3RKRFgySXBPcURpOTJZRVNyUWpRMllRZmdENFhPZkVh?= =?utf-8?B?SEIvRHUzUVR6cHM5VkhQT1pFMUZ0RXptT0tFRndmZmh5dlJlU1pNRVpEN3B4?= =?utf-8?B?TDB1bFAzbHErWWhGMWp4cElqRnhybUFmSStoZXJoWEVHdWc4c3laTGc2N2N5?= =?utf-8?B?TzY4Q1k4L1o5ZDdNNVpuSnUyN3YvSFI0dGVCM29IRkM4ZTNYdmlzSXJkQmwv?= =?utf-8?B?OTV5SVZLY3Y1V01jY1J6Q1VtdGlCMnU0U1EzaDlIL3V1L3JFT0R3MkhqTTdr?= =?utf-8?B?RytzdUJsWVc5b25ORy9xMkpFdjFEMWZaS2JBYmI0NnZvYzhvM0tqdk9jVVlx?= =?utf-8?B?YyszL1JyeTh5d1ZHY0tSZHY3VWZnZ1JqYVl1YytwYXk2MWpaQStUbk9odFFr?= =?utf-8?B?NlFuOGpkM21wcXRmTzBUSTZmc2w5cVpxOGkvTTc4d0Y1WU44a0pDUlFaTTZz?= =?utf-8?B?UlNYWlVYMG9pTmt1c3h4V3QyeExGK2F6TXRQWEhwN1JMeXZ5WDZtQVBwdWZj?= =?utf-8?B?Um5uZWRaMHJ0L2hySEFaZ3FTUzZaMExkTHhDcTlBVDFxcnZxSWFIOHNSZ2JV?= =?utf-8?B?bTh1VjBGU0Y4cUZnRjJMNGhjc3JhY3RhM2lSQXhtL3E3UFNuM2lpaGgvQ05r?= =?utf-8?B?MmR3YlN2RFlUMjVaL1BiQ3BYVTVxcG9iUE81YWRGZm9EY3FDYzlYemJiUDFn?= =?utf-8?B?K1lyVFYvWC8rRS9sbTI4TkY3TFNUN2ZiMWtWVDkvdDd3Vk5Pd1U4dGdsSm9s?= =?utf-8?B?aGZ1UE1kTzg2QzZhaXFBNEVGVlpaeDREaUQ4dzBYTG9XMEJQeUtZM1hydkoz?= =?utf-8?B?Y2Iwb2txMXJzaDI1Y2kvdk81dTNFL241OHduNFpQekU1ZDh0K1p6elphZzN3?= =?utf-8?B?YmNVVlFmeHBWZFY3UjVIMUhFYUZteSt1eTgzYzY1TUs4RVJxdU5yTElxSHJa?= =?utf-8?B?RmtNQ0RTUjdoMU5DMVY2TXF2dk16Q0NqN01BOHdyTVNZdXFSWmdTWk1TckF4?= =?utf-8?B?RHZDTnNZeHNCTm5lL3QwR0M5R2hNQ2Z6S2NSV1lKTjFyQ0taMnJ3WXR0RE9q?= =?utf-8?B?eld4enhSYms1c3NxNzZJSjZBZWZ2dmhScGxWUDR4QWFDZXJ2V2wwckRqRVRP?= =?utf-8?B?cVhyWlllczNoS0poQzFNdWljNnVzcExNNjdHZk5HSmhLVCtwV3hVWTJmVk5a?= =?utf-8?B?VXRXclBlaFF1K0ZQQzJWQ28vaTAvaVN3TUFzMXlnRmh5S3o2M1RzVmd6aEtk?= =?utf-8?B?VHkrMExDQ1pheFZnMmxJYTJneGoxUHlSMVZxbEd2K0V6WmNYV2Vtd1IxYXBr?= =?utf-8?B?TG1OQUlvVjViTFVxbVVDMWRRYU5YNXhSRTVPTWNXYVJIU1BHSTMxQmt6bmJj?= =?utf-8?B?a1VJVU9DLzhlTG5Ib1k3ZW9uSUdja1FLNkNhakxmRVoxOFRIMjVSSEV6VXBz?= =?utf-8?B?bi9jUjNraVZTbVE1ZUltMU00SUd3aHp6UWcvY0JBY21BVVpwS2w5SHAwM2lz?= =?utf-8?B?aFBzTGNDUm9DNkt6UERwSkpCR0V2dzV1MHBOQmRjYnk1YitBa3JCNXlYaWQ1?= =?utf-8?B?NEY0SHExZ1FpZzk0UGQ2YkRRQU1QejdXZzZkdjJ4dzlTdXJjdDJ6UDVYb1Vu?= =?utf-8?B?YW5UdVViaXp3RGZmU1ZsT2NaWFg0SXJoaXBRWUlURlNuVzE2R1VjUXc1MHAr?= =?utf-8?Q?HiJWddPsaQPL+QT9zADj?= X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?WEExeGljMUpVSTZXTkNWc0hvQTliNHFkYWY0QVp1L1VacWN6S1pjMWpLS242?= =?utf-8?B?bi9ZQlk1OWZXb3I2N3FtZWRtOVdldlpqclFGYS9UUit3RGVJTmJvcWVGZkg3?= =?utf-8?B?ckRlcG1MQy83eDJ6UW8zN082cFZlZDd5eGpkNjhxaFZaQ2hNUm16TXEzeE9n?= =?utf-8?B?aWN6dWhCb2JuRlRwZlVSRWtuZXRybytYdzZ4aDVya2R0R1JLdjU4UXR5N21F?= =?utf-8?B?cWVnaEE5a0Jkc1FEeCtQR3BOQ2FGTGovWTRmZ3BTMElJNE5UbHpmSGhRYWov?= =?utf-8?B?UjRVbER6ZytydzBmdUk0aHRxWG1yWk1kZWNNWXhKZVE5a2RBVjVtWnUwMTJn?= =?utf-8?B?bmpYQ1BmWHp6T1Fwd3E5TWJFYmZqbVZWNlJYVUUyRE1GV08yYmJneVNJODhU?= =?utf-8?B?VDEraUtEZGlXbFljcmtSUUIvUXZ6cUVTdGFLVGhtOUp0cmdoRkt5emlYOXVT?= =?utf-8?B?U0JTcndqZmkwckM3QktDWG5RMjdLN0J2NzRsZWFaZ1BCUFRHOCtZTUpDa0ZN?= =?utf-8?B?LzdXYVBxVDlQbFdmMmxmVE5QMWJiNUpZZXViRDNXNXF2aC8vU3puRWNteEJJ?= =?utf-8?B?cHIzUlJhUnRuSXh2MWJQc0lseDRWQkdRNExiREpMVXc3bllGdklxVlNvYlRZ?= =?utf-8?B?RDZERC9MdjZRbG9SdUFORTYybVV4S1U2WndqOEhUbWJZK3pJakhYU2hBaWFq?= =?utf-8?B?bFVsUkExa0Q0UTZwTi9CU0pkYVNDRjdBVVdZNUJuSzlyN1RFNlJudHZ4c3Nx?= =?utf-8?B?WldNVEg0d0pFbythYnJ4U01Td0RSdjhjUjNWWHBPSDNDNElkWFpLbEFtR2Vo?= =?utf-8?B?Z1VBRzFUMlNYRzhJN0RJdXpmVzlsWnVORXpQd2xoS1pvL0lkcS9VUmdSQkE3?= =?utf-8?B?OTI1dUljVXh5bUhRdXJ6NHNKZkloRTczejFIZ3d3M3lXOGNsMWxaTjZiWnBw?= =?utf-8?B?czJiRWFQMmpxUmw5T3hGV0g1QXpvd25QQ2NpcTFqQWl3T2I1ZEpLOFltUWdl?= =?utf-8?B?NzJhTXNDV1ZYNE54aDlCMGZTcHNpZnJnWldFL29UbUZ4emxocC9PQk9WVFdU?= =?utf-8?B?VTZ3YVFkRHJRUXcrU2ZpM1kwSkdTWC9VejI4cU4zM2pqckY0TWlkUG52MWF6?= =?utf-8?B?S3MvS1FqYmp1NS9mUkNjcE1PcHR4eElVYVdDaG95K241bGZGUzlWWjNGa2xr?= =?utf-8?B?cktCd3d4c09FZzErem11QmdlSnlwQ09HUXdOdUVPUDVGZDVYbk5UVzhmZ2p4?= =?utf-8?B?YXA5YzEweXBBWmNHRjVEYWpuMHd4ZnVjZllKMVVBaW9vLy9FcDIyV0FMM3d0?= =?utf-8?B?aHVWQlFGZGxzQzBIVGFoUEpEV2lZbEY4dnRNTDkvOEpKY2J2MURJbDF6Nld0?= =?utf-8?B?ZE43eHZjQ0VsZUlad1NKaHhqVmViMitOYkxzSDdaT0hGbk1LZ1NYMVFnN3Bu?= =?utf-8?B?N2QzbWNjM3YwdkhEeWZMSkhxTXBEU2JJR3dtRkxTUHpoSEFUWEpodGZUdFhY?= =?utf-8?B?dFhuYkduR2FOSmpPOFo5bW1YaFBiV0d5aXpuMkRORmlOWjY2UmNtUHg1M2JN?= =?utf-8?B?RHZvZ3h4eThMbllpUlptOHdlWlBrZEd2N3JiQ1BzQTBPQ21MRnE3OEltTStS?= =?utf-8?B?aWRUK1pVRHVBejhDdHZNbEFXaWRZMFV2TVl4UDYxang4d0twZkk1NVdteElp?= =?utf-8?B?cGdFT3ZNR0ZWMG5NbGdPTlJFaU1ETlg5dSt5S3l6ZFJyem5MaERMZG40elgz?= =?utf-8?B?Z0hiZVdzT2NYOE0yakZwMUNBeWV6eVVZNUVXUFl1dE1Gams0N1lVdjhsSEJ1?= =?utf-8?B?Z2R1RjlTbWRJWEFOajdsZz09?= X-OriginatorOrg: out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 085b8b31-4912-480a-29f6-08ddba523e57 X-MS-Exchange-CrossTenant-AuthSource: AS8P250MB0744.EURP250.PROD.OUTLOOK.COM X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 03 Jul 2025 16:54:15.6336 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 84df9e7f-e9f6-40af-b435-aaaaaaaaaaaa X-MS-Exchange-CrossTenant-RMS-PersistedConsumerOrg: 00000000-0000-0000-0000-000000000000 X-MS-Exchange-Transport-CrossTenantHeadersStamped: GV2P250MB0755 Subject: Re: [FFmpeg-devel] [PATCH 0/4] Check sample rate generically X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: ffmpegagent: > This is an alternative to > https://ffmpeg.org/pipermail/ffmpeg-devel/2025-June/345575.html. > > Andreas Rheinhardt (4): > avcodec/avcodec: Check sample_rate generically > avcodec/wma,wmaprodec: Remove always-false checks > avcodec/wma: Remove redundant nb_channels check > avcodec/wmaprodec: Avoid branch for setting block_align > > libavcodec/avcodec.c | 6 +++++- > libavcodec/encode.c | 5 ----- > libavcodec/wma.c | 4 ++-- > libavcodec/wmaprodec.c | 20 +++++++------------- > 4 files changed, 14 insertions(+), 21 deletions(-) > > > base-commit: 34953e195fe108224abdfe25d147f1a7ba5477c8 > Published-As: https://github.com/ffstaging/FFmpeg/releases/tag/pr-ffstaging-101%2Fmkver%2Fsample_rate_check-v1 > Fetch-It-Via: git fetch https://github.com/ffstaging/FFmpeg pr-ffstaging-101/mkver/sample_rate_check-v1 > Pull-Request: https://github.com/ffstaging/FFmpeg/pull/101 Will apply this patchset tonight unless there are objections. - Andreas _______________________________________________ ffmpeg-devel mailing list ffmpeg-devel@ffmpeg.org https://ffmpeg.org/mailman/listinfo/ffmpeg-devel To unsubscribe, visit link above, or email ffmpeg-devel-request@ffmpeg.org with subject "unsubscribe".